|
|
马上注册,结识高手,享用更多资源,轻松玩转三维网社区。
您需要 登录 才可以下载或查看,没有帐号?注册
x
(defun c:1-18();网球
. W7 k3 o: n/ a9 `9 B: a, A9 U (setq n (getint "\n顶点的数量<4>:")), y7 u5 S5 m' n( s! f
(if (null n) (setq n 4))* l3 M! h: f! M _5 X
(setq r (getint "\n球半径<10>:"))& I5 ]$ Y) K; J" @; [8 |1 ~8 r
(if (null r) (setq r 10)): m$ Q$ h/ t0 c& n. J
(setq 5 {" A2 e: F2 T
s (sin 0.339836909)
: q# S; E6 o1 ^) k" Z( t/ W c (cos 0.339836909) 2 a( w& Z8 s) W3 s
)
6 p G) [1 A0 A& ] (setq d0 (list 0 0 0))+ f! p( W, l7 G" w1 u
(setq d1 (list
; L( B% z* L, X6 n (* r c -1) 2 Q6 I4 i: |2 j$ r2 z$ h, l, }/ `
(* r s -1) 7 ?+ f, Q2 k1 R ~! O( Y3 @
0
: X) _: Y' }* b! N ) 4 k; J# t1 x3 ~6 u N
)1 ~4 J6 h; U* W. a, \: k
(setq d2 (list " n" R% C3 g' e& G0 w/ `
(* r c (cos (/ pi 3)))
' _6 i2 c! d$ G; X% E (* r s -1) ! N! Y8 D0 I1 J3 D3 C! W
(* r c (sin (/ pi 3)) -1)0 F6 d' _2 m" c- Q2 a% Y
) % I O& A3 x8 H7 F: {) V( B* M
)- z5 w; |5 v i6 t/ O
(setq d3 (list
9 [: [; U2 [7 G5 P8 g% z+ B (* r c (cos (/ pi 3)))
$ o. Z( y! c- {8 _ (* r s -1)
9 e# K' f- N6 w. { (* r c (sin (/ pi 3)))
, g4 Z. Z* X' H5 Z )
0 N2 e. N" Q. r6 B, _* j" A )
x3 e% T4 B# _% q4 { (setq d4 (list 0 r 0))
2 H: A. J$ p0 P (command "line" d1 d2 "")
9 \6 G, O2 O0 G8 B, K ?: m+ |* | (command "line" d1 d3 "")
+ K1 v5 x4 T" u+ G$ Z B7 [ (command "line" d3 d2 "")
0 l' u1 N. d0 u# \* ?. M (command "line" d1 d4 "")
3 Q" \9 o. V; ]1 o (command "line" d4 d2 ""), ^" G; z$ A' R* @ r
(command "line" d4 d3 "")- L9 E% Q1 c( t& x$ b2 c5 X7 c, S
(command "line" d0 d1 "")
- z5 ~ M; v+ \% b. E5 H; k (command "line" d0 d2 "")
% r6 H" `, Q t$ C( Q! { (command "line" d0 d3 "")
% Q# a& Q5 l3 o (command "line" d0 d4 "")8 v5 X, H, Y% x4 p( `. H4 ]) `; v+ P u0 f
;(vla-AddSphere d0 r)" [8 L( p$ m* I; e! o' f( _( t
(prin1)
, ?8 w& F- _! H)% C! `+ l: q9 b3 ?5 l& b$ `- t
- F+ T( l- a4 Q9 `, B6 V
|
|